Andhra Pradesh Sees Significant Decline in Child Labour Cases: Officials

Speedy Summary

  • sharp Decline in Child Labor Cases: Andhra Pradesh reported a drop in child labour cases from 1,040 (2023) to 584 (2024), and further to 291 (2025).

– Hazardous sectors: Cases decreased from 63 (2023) to 24 (2024) and further reduced to 15 (2025).
– Non-hazardous establishments: Declined from 977 (2023) to 560 (2024), eventually reaching 276 in 2025.

  • Financial Rehabilitation: Rescued children received back wage disbursements totaling ₹17.35 lakh in 2023, ₹14.80 lakh in 2024, and ₹4.82 lakh in 2025.
  • Legal Enforcement Actions Against Employers: Penalties for employers amounted to:

– ₹20,000 per case, totaling ₹4.4 lakh collected for violations reported in 22 cases during the year of 2023.
